I got this error as I wrote a plugin for firefox. I used the basic
plugin outline from: <http://stackoverflow.com/questions/8507670/basic-
plugin-npapi-npruntime-hello-world>.
When I want to initialize Gtk3 (gtkmm) in the NP_Initialize function
with:
Gtk::Main::init_gtkmm_internals ();
then it hangs and I got the following (same) errors:
(plugin-container:21564): GLib-GObject-WARNING **: cannot register existing
type `GdkWindow'
(plugin-container:21564): GLib-CRITICAL **: g_once_init_leave: assertion
`result != 0' failed
I guess the error commes from because firefox uses Gtk2 and when a
plugin used Gtk3 then there are so strange errors.
